Income share of the richest 1% (before tax) in Montenegro
Montenegro: Income share of the richest 1% (before tax) was 9.0% in 2021. β² Rising
Income share of the richest 1% (before tax) in Montenegro, 1984β2021
Source: World Inequality Database (WID.world) (2026) β with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in %.
Analysis
In 2021, income share of the richest 1% (before tax) in Montenegro stood at 9.0%.
That represents a change of up 3.2% on the previous year and down 13.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, income share of the richest 1% (before tax) in Montenegro peaked at 11.0% in 2015 and was at its lowest, 6.6%, in 1990.
Montenegro ranks 103rd of 113 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 19 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 7.5% | 6.8% | 8.0% | 5 |
| 1990s | 7.7% | 6.6% | 8.8% | 2 |
| 2000s | 9.3% | 8.8% | 9.7% | 5 |
| 2010s | 10.2% | 9.4% | 11.0% | 5 |
| 2020s | 8.9% | 8.7% | 9.0% | 2 |
